Recipe 1: Shredded Chicken
Ingredients:
- 1 lb shredded cooked chicken
- 1 cup hot sauce
- 1 cup ranch dressing
- 1 cup crumbled blue cheese
- 1/2 cup sour cream
- 1/4 cup chopped green onions
- Tortilla chips or celery sticks, for serving
Instructions:
- Preheat oven to 350°F (175°C).
- In a large bowl, mix together hot sauce, ranch dressing, blue cheese, sour cream, and green onions until combined.
- Stir in the shredded chicken until evenly coated.
- Transfer the mixture to a 9-inch baking dish.
- Bake for 20-25 minutes, until the dip is hot and bubbly.
- Serve with tortilla chips or celery sticks for dipping.

Recipe 2: Rotisserie Chicken
Ingredients:
- 1 rotisserie chicken, shredded
- 1 cup hot sauce
- 1 cup mayonnaise
- 1/2 cup crumbled blue cheese
- 1/4 cup chopped green onions
- Tortilla chips or celery sticks, for serving
Instructions:
- Preheat oven to 350°F (175°C).
- In a large bowl, mix together hot sauce, mayonnaise, blue cheese, and green onions until combined.
- Stir in the shredded rotisserie chicken until evenly coated.
- Transfer the mixture to a 9-inch baking dish.
- Bake for 20-25 minutes, until the dip is hot and bubbly.
- Serve with tortilla chips or celery sticks for dipping.
